| 5.2 高层次综合的内容 5.2.4 结果生成与反编译 高层次综合的最后阶段需要把设计转化到硬件结构的物理实现,这可以用较低层次的设计工具实现:用逻辑综合工具对组合逻辑进行优化,然后用版图综合工具进行版图设计。 由于控制器的综合可以单独进行,所以把高层次综合的结果作为控制器综合工具的输入。这里需要事先约定输入/输出的格式,以便相互衔接。 数字系统的行为描述经过高层次综合后到达寄存器传输级。在寄存器传输级,数字系统由数据通路和控制器组成。控制器用一个有限状态机(或微程序)表示;数据通路则由3类硬件模块组成的模块集合表示。这3类硬件模块是:功能单元、存储单元和互连线网。图5.7给出这3类硬件模块的图例。 |